    Abstract: AbstractThis study optimized the ratio of substrate (S) to seed inoculum (S:I) in anaerobic digestion of mixed vegetable market complex waste (MVW) for enhanced biogas production. Different types of vegetable waste possess different characters ...Process of optimizing substrate to seed inoculum ratio (S to I) in anaerobic digestion (AD) of Koyambedu Wholesale Vegetable Market Complex (KWVMC) waste. Waste is collected from KMVMC in Chennai, India, where 300 tonnes of mixed vegetable waste are ...
